iOS apps start from USD 8,000 for applications with defined features and a clear set of screens. More complex apps with advanced integrations, offline features, custom backend or specific hardware capabilities are scoped and priced accordingly.
Apple's review process typically takes 1-2 weeks for the first version. Once approved, updates usually take 1-3 days. We recommend factoring this into your launch calendar.
Native is the right choice when you need deep hardware access (ARKit, Core Motion, HealthKit, Bluetooth BLE), the best possible user experience, maximum performance, or when your audience is primarily iPhone users and quality is a competitive advantage. If you need both iOS and Android with limited budget and standard features, React Native is a valid alternative we also evaluate.
Yes, you need an Apple Developer account at USD 99/year. We can help you create one or work under your existing account. We can also develop under our account and transfer it at launch.
Yes. We design the data architecture for the app to work offline with automatic sync when connection is restored — especially important for field apps, logistics or use in areas with intermittent signal.
Yes. We develop the app from the start to work perfectly on both iPhone and iPad, leveraging the larger iPad screen with adapted layouts. It's one project that covers both devices.
